Paper Pumpkin is Stampin’ Up!’s monthly crafting subscription.  It’s everything you love about Stampin’ Up! on autopilot.

Just think of it as a Stampin’ Up! surprise delivered to your doorstep every month!  Your monthly kit features exclusive products you can only get through Paper Pumpkin.

Try it and see what you think. You can cancel your membership any time.  


Want to Know More?
  • Each month you’ll receive a unique, surprise kit with a project-cards, journals, décor, and more! Everything is color-coordinated, measured, and cut just for you!

  • Each kit includes stamps, ink, paper, and accessories-everything but adhesive.

  • Each kit takes about 30 minutes to complete. A much needed, creativity escape.

  • Paper Pumpkin is a FANTASTIC to-go kit!  It contains everything you need to take your kit traveling, camping, to friends homes, etc.!

  • Stampin’ Up! will ship your Paper Pumpkin on or around the 15th of the month.

  • You need to sign up for a kit by the 10th of the month to get that month’s kit. If you sign up on the 11th of the month, your first kit will come the next month. For example, if you sign up on May 10th, Stampin’ Up! will send your kit around May 15th. If you sign up on May 11th, they’ll send your first kit around June 15th.

  • There’s no commitment, you can cancel your monthly Paper Pumpkin at anytime. You also have the option to skip a month if you want.

Paper Pumpkin - (Frequently Asked Questions)

Paper Pumpkin FAQs

Q: Why are we offering Paper Pumpkin?
A:
Good question. Paper Pumpkin is the perfect introduction to Stampin’ Up! We designed it for crafters that want to create a project each month, but aren’t quite ready to build a stamp collection (yet).

Q: What comes in my Paper Pumpkin?
A:
It’s a surprise each month-anticipation for the surprise is seriously half the fun! No worries, though, you’ll have everything you need to complete the project: paper, stamps, ink, accessories, and more! (You will need adhesive and the block that comes in your first kit.)

Q: Does my Paper Pumpkin project come with instructions?
A: Yes, of course it does. The instructions will tell you everything you need to know. And they are so easy to follow-we promise.

Q: How long will it take to make each Paper Pumpkin project? (Now say that fast three times.)
A: We know you wish you had unlimited creativity time (we all do), but since you probably don’t, we designed each Paper Pumpkin to be completed in 30 minutes or less! (We think of it as a spa treatment for your creativity.)

Q: How much does a Paper Pumpkin membership cost each month?
A: Paper Pumpkin is $22.00 per month. Because your Paper Pumpkin ships automatically to you, we have already built in the shipping costs of $6.00 to the cost of each kit. (sales tax not included)

Q: When does my membership expire?
A: Your membership will last until you cancel it.

Q: When do I need to sign up in order to get my Paper Pumpkin?
A: You need to sign up on or before the 10th of the month in order to receive your Paper Pumpkin for that month. If you sign up after the 10th#no worries! You will get your first kit the following month. You’ll know your Paper Pumpkin is on its way when you receive your shipment confirmation e-mail.

Q: Can I skip a month?
A: You sure can! Simply log on to your account and click “manage my pumpkin”, then click “skip a month” on or before the 10th of the month in order to skip the Paper Pumpkin for that month. If you do this on the 11th of the month, you will receive that month’s Paper Pumpkin and not receive the following month’s Paper Pumpkin.

Q: What if I want to cancel my membership?
A:
You must submit a 10-page essay about why you would ever want to do such a crazy thing. (Just kidding.) It’s simple. Simply log on to your account and click “manage my pumpkin”, then click “cancel” on or before the 10 th of the month in order to cancel completely. Then, you will not receive any more Paper Pumpkin kits (how sad). If you cancel on the 11th of the month, you’ll receive that month’s Paper Pumpkin and will not receive any more Paper Pumpkin kits.

Q: What is the return policy?
A: If you are not thrilled with your Paper Pumpkin, please call us at 1-800-STAMP UP, we’ll chat and make make everything hunky dory.

Q: Will the items in each Paper Pumpkin be available for sale individually?
A: Part of the fun of having a Paper Pumpkin membership is receiving exclusive products to play with! Most of the items in your Paper Pumpkin are exclusive, never-before seen products (can you say yippee?) You will, however, see a few tried-and-true products in your Paper Pumpkin that you can buy individually in the catalog.

Q: How do I see the upcoming Paper Pumpkin kits?
A:
One of the best parts of your Paper Pumpkin membership is that you never know what is going to be in that beautiful red box. It’s like opening a present every month-we don’t want to ruin the surprise for you!  You will be able to see what the project will contain (cards, bags, etc.) and what colors will be used.

Q: What is the Welcome Kit?
A: If you are a new member, we’ll send the Welcome kit to you for your first month.  The Welcome Kit is the same box everyone else gets with a Bonus! the Welcome Kit includes a free gift-a clear acrylic block!

Q: What is the free gift?
A: You will receive a special free gift with your Welcome kit-a clear-mount acrylic block. You will need your clear block each month to use the stamps that will come with your Paper Pumpkin. Simply press the stamp firmly onto the clear block and the stamp will adhere to the block. Ink up your stamp, and you are ready to go! When you are finished stamping, just peel the stamp off the block. 

Q: Why is the shipping different on Paper Pumpkin?
A: Your Paper Pumpkin will be automatically shipped to you each month (so fun!). Because we are auto shipping these, the pricing structure is slightly different from our other Stampin’ Up! products.

Q: Can I buy multiple memberships to save shipping?
A:
You can buy as many memberships as you want to, but the price for shipping remains the same.  Because we ship each Paper Pumpkin to you in its very own pretty red box, the price for the monthly shipping has already been built into the Paper Pumpkin cost.

Q: When will the package arrive?
A:
Your Paper Pumpkin will ship from the Stampin’ Up! warehouse on or around the 15th of the month. You will get an e-mail notifying you that your card has been charged-expect your Paper Pumpkin soon!

Q: What if the package never comes?
A:
If your Paper Pumpkin does not arrive on your doorstep please call us at 1-800-STAMP UP, and one of our friendly customer service agents will help you.

Q: When will I be charged?
A: Your credit card will be charged as soon as your Paper Pumpkin ships.
